Tawakkul is one of the most prominent forms of belief in Allah (SWT) and one of its terms. The meaning of faith in Allah in Islam is to believe in Allah’s existence, lordship, divinity, and attributes.

Furthermore, when you have faith in Allah, you believe in his oneness, his books, the existence of his angels, his prophets and messengers, and the judgment day.

Allah says in the Quran describing the belief of Prophet Muhammad (PBUH) and his companions putting the ideals to other Muslims: 

“The Messenger firmly believes in what has been revealed to him from his Lord, and so do the believers. They all believe in Allah, His angels, His Books, and His messengers. They proclaim”

(2:285) Al Baqarah.

Another definition of Faith in Islam is to believe that Allah is the only creator of the entire universe and the only one who preserves the worship. Tawakul in Allah is a part of the honest belief in him. So, we will highlight the elaborate definition of tawakkul in Islam.

What is Tawakkul in Allah?

The definition of Tawakkul in Allah is complete trust in him and his plans for his believers, as your belief in Allah won’t be firmed and total without trust in him.

In The Arabic Language, Tawakkul means dependence on Allah in all life matters, besides the trust in him and his plans. These definitions translate the concept of honest belief in Allah.

What are the Levels of Tawakkul in Islam?

There are four levels of Tawakkul in Islam, according to the Islamic scholars’ classification:

A. The First Level is Believing in Allah’s Attributes

This level is to believe in Allah’s attributes as he is the one that Muslims should rely on him in all life matters. Moreover, this level is about the belief that Allah is the only one who knows what will happen in the future and everything on earth or in the whole universe happens with his will.

B. The Second Level – Adopting means reaching an end

In the second level, Muslims believe there is a reason for everything that happens in their lives. So you need to adopt the required means to reach your targeted goal

C. The Third Level – Trust in Allah

This level is about depending on Allah alone. It defines the complete reliance on Allah and trust in Him that He (SWT) will guide you to whatever is good for you here in this life or in the hereafter.  

D. The Fourth Level – Sincerity

Believers of this level rely on Allah in sincerity. This reliance accompanies the feeling of comfort and reassurance.

Why is Tawakkul important?

Once you put your trust in Allah, you’ll gain many benefits like

  • You’ll eliminate anxiety and doubts and feel peaceful as tawakkul strengthens your faith in Allah and trust in his plans for you.
  • You’ll have actual knowledge of Allah and his greatness.
  • You’ll be closer to Allah and more Righteous.
  • You’ll figure out that Allah responds to your calling and dua can change your fate.
  • You’ll learn how to be satisfied if something you want doesn’t happen, as you’ll figure out that Allah’s plan is better for you.
  • You’ll have strong faith that protects you from satan’s temptations.

What is the difference between Tawakkul and Tawkkal?

In the Arabic Language, there is one difference between tawakkul and tawakkal in writing. The difference is one letter between them.

Also, there is a difference between Tawakkul and Tawkkal in meaning. Tawakkul means reliance on Allah and trust in him alone. 

As for Tawwakal, it means waiting for Allah’s assistance without seeking any meaning that may achieve this goal.

For example, tawakkal is when a student makes a dua for Allah to pass the exam although he didn’t study or get ready for it well, as he should work hard and then make dua for Allah for success. 

This concept is related to executing the required means to achieve a certain goal while relying on Allah that He will guide you and pave the way for you, with no reliance on any causes or means.

What does Quran say about Tawakkul?

In the noble Quran, Allah mentioned tawakkul in many verses.

1. Trust in Allah when making decisions:

فَإِذَا عَزَمْتَ فَتَوَكَّلْ عَلَى ٱللَّهِ ۚ إِنَّ ٱللَّهَ يُحِبُّ ٱلْمُتَوَكِّلِينَ
“Once you make a decision, put your trust in Allah. Surely Allah loves those who trust in Him”

(3:159) Surah Ali ‘Imran – 159

2. Allah is sufficient for those who trust in him and rely on Allah 

وَمَن يَتَوَكَّلْ عَلَى ٱللَّهِ فَهُوَ حَسْبُهُۥٓ ۚ إِنَّ ٱللَّهَ بَـٰلِغُ أَمْرِهِۦ ۚ قَدْ جَعَلَ ٱللَّهُ لِكُلِّ شَىْءٍۢ قَدْرًۭا
And whosoever puts his trust in Allah then He will suffice him, Certainly, Allah achieves His Will. Allah has already set a destiny for everything.

Surah At-Talaq – 3

In Surah Al-Tawba, Allah talks to the prophet Muhammed (PBUH) and orders him to say that Allah is sufficient for him and put his trust in him:

فَإِن تَوَلَّوْا۟ فَقُلْ حَسْبِىَ ٱللَّهُ لَآ إِلَـٰهَ إِلَّا هُوَ ۖ عَلَيْهِ تَوَكَّلْتُ ۖ وَهُوَ رَبُّ ٱلْعَرْشِ ٱلْعَظِيمِ

{But if they turn away, then say, O Prophet, “Allah is sufficient for me. There is no god worthy of worship except Him. In Him, I put my trust. And He is the Lord of the Mighty Throne}

Surah At-Tawbah – 129

3. All matters in the heavens and earth are subject to Allah. In Surah Hud, Allah orders us to worship him and put trust in him, as all matters in the heavens and earth are subject to Allah:

وَلِلَّهِ غَيْبُ ٱلسَّمَـٰوَٰتِ وَٱلْأَرْضِ وَإِلَيْهِ يُرْجَعُ ٱلْأَمْرُ كُلُّهُۥ فَٱعْبُدْهُ وَتَوَكَّلْ عَلَيْهِ ۚ وَمَا رَبُّكَ بِغَـٰفِلٍ عَمَّا تَعْمَلُونَ

To Allah ˹alone˺ belongs the knowledge of what is hidden in the heavens and the earth. And to Him, all matters are returned. So worship Him and put your trust in Him. And your Lord is never unaware of what you do.

Surah Hud – 123

4. In Surah ‘Ankabut, Believers who trusted in Allah will be living in paradise in the Hereafter:

وَٱلَّذِينَ ءَامَنُوا۟ وَعَمِلُوا۟ ٱلصَّـٰلِحَـٰتِ لَنُبَوِّئَنَّهُم مِّنَ ٱلْجَنَّةِ غُرَفًۭا تَجْرِى مِن تَحْتِهَا ٱلْأَنْهَـٰرُ خَـٰلِدِينَ فِيهَا ۚ نِعْمَ أَجْرُ ٱلْعَـٰمِلِينَ – ٱلَّذِينَ صَبَرُوا۟ وَعَلَىٰ رَبِّهِمْ يَتَوَكَّلُونَ

{As for those who believe and do good, We will certainly house them in elevated mansions in Paradise, under which rivers flow, to stay there forever. How excellent is the reward for those who work ˹righteousness – those who patiently endure, and put their trust in their Lord.”

Surah Al-‘Ankabut – 58-59

How do you pray tawakkul pray?

In Islam, there is a prayer representing the concept of reliance on Allah called “Istikhara”, but its name isn’t tawakkul prayer as usually said in the west.

Muslims perform Istikhara “tawakkul” prayer when they feel confused and hesitant to take the right choice or decision for them between two difficult choices. They ask Allah to guide them to the correct choice.

After the Istikhara prayer, Muslims make a dua for Allah and say what Prophet Muhammed (PBUH) said: 

“O Allah, I ask You for the good by Your knowledge, and I ask You for strength by Your power, and I ask You for some of Your immense abundant favor. You have the power, and I do not. You know, and I do not know. You are the Knower of the Unseen Worlds.

O Allah, if You know that this affair is good for me in my deen, my livelihood and the end of my affair and its conclusion, then decree it for me. 

And If you know it is bad for me…..then avert it from me and avert me from it. Decree the good wherever it is for me and then make me content”.

How do you trust Allah in hard times?

Sometimes believers experience harsh situations that measure their strength of faith in Allah. These situations require us to be closer to Allah and trust his plan. So, there are ways that achieve and increase your confidence in Allah in hard times:

  • Keep reciting Quran daily, as it strengthens your relationship with Allah and boosts your trust in him.
  • Adhere to morning and evening adhkar every day. They increase your religiosity.
  • Identify Allah’s attributes to figure out his greatness.
  • Keep asking Allah for overcoming your sadness, and be sure that he is listening to your duaa and able to achieve whatever you want as he is close to you. Allah says:

وَإِذَا سَأَلَكَ عِبَادِى عَنِّى فَإِنِّى قَرِيبٌ ۖ أُجِيبُ دَعْوَةَ ٱلدَّاعِ إِذَا دَعَانِ ۖ فَلْيَسْتَجِيبُوا۟ لِى وَلْيُؤْمِنُوا۟ بِى لَعَلَّهُمْ يَرْشُدُونَ

When My servants ask you ˹O Prophet˺ About Me: I am truly near. I respond to one’s prayer when they call upon Me. So let them respond ˹with obedience˺ to Me and believe in Me, perhaps they will be guided ˹to the Right Way˺.

Surah Al-Baqarah – 186
  • Increase your Faith in Allah by doing his obligations.
  • Be satisfied with Allah’s decisions for you, and always praise him.
  • Ask Allah’s forgiveness in total sincerity if you commit something forbidden, and make sure that Allah forgives his believers.
